VMware服务器虚拟化架构详解图
vmware服务器虚拟化架构图

首页 2025-03-11 19:53:53



VMware服务器虚拟化架构深度解析 在当今这个信息化高速发展的时代,数据中心作为企业IT架构的核心,面临着前所未有的挑战

    随着业务需求的不断增长,传统的“一台服务器一个应用程序”模式已经无法满足高效、灵活、可扩展的IT服务需求

    VMware服务器虚拟化技术的出现,如同一股清新的春风,为数据中心带来了革命性的变革

    本文将通过解析VMware服务器虚拟化架构图,深入探讨其工作原理、优势以及应用场景,为您展现这一技术的无限魅力

     一、VMware服务器虚拟化架构概览 VMware服务器虚拟化架构,以其独特的设计理念和强大的功能,成为了企业IT架构升级的首选方案

    该架构主要由以下几个核心组件构成:物理主机(ESXi主机)、虚拟化管理程序(vCenter Server)、虚拟机(VM)以及存储系统

    这些组件相互协作,共同构建了一个高效、灵活、可扩展的虚拟化环境

     1.物理主机(ESXi主机):作为虚拟化架构的基础,ESXi主机是安装了VMware ESXi虚拟化软件的物理服务器

    ESXi软件将物理服务器的硬件资源抽象成虚拟资源,供虚拟机使用

    每台ESXi主机都可以运行多个虚拟机,实现了硬件资源的最大化利用

     2.虚拟化管理程序(vCenter Server):vCenter Server是VMware虚拟化架构的管理中心,它提供了对虚拟化环境的集中管理和监控功能

    通过vCenter Server,管理员可以轻松管理数百台ESXi主机和数千个虚拟机,实现资源的动态调配、故障预警和恢复等功能

     3.虚拟机(VM):虚拟机是运行在ESXi主机上的虚拟操作系统实例

    每个虚拟机都具有独立的CPU、内存、存储和网络资源,可以运行不同的操作系统和应用程序

    虚拟机的出现,打破了传统物理服务器之间的界限,实现了应用程序的灵活部署和快速迁移

     4.存储系统:存储系统是虚拟化架构中不可或缺的一部分

    它负责存储虚拟机的镜像文件、配置文件和日志文件等关键数据

    VMware提供了多种存储解决方案,包括本地磁盘、网络附加存储(NAS)、存储区域网络(SAN)等,以满足不同场景下的存储需求

     二、VMware服务器虚拟化架构工作原理 VMware服务器虚拟化架构的工作原理,基于虚拟化技术的核心——虚拟化管理程序(Hypervisor)

    Hypervisor在物理硬件和虚拟机之间创建了一个隔离层,使得多个虚拟机可以在同一台物理服务器上并行运行,且互不干扰

     1.资源抽象与隔离:Hypervisor将物理服务器的CPU、内存、存储和网络等硬件资源抽象成虚拟资源,并分配给各个虚拟机使用

    同时,Hypervisor还提供了资源隔离机制,确保虚拟机之间的运行互不干扰,提高了系统的稳定性和安全性

     2.动态资源调配:vCenter Server通过监控和分析虚拟化环境的运行状态,可以动态地调配资源,以满足不同虚拟机对资源的需求

    例如,当某个虚拟机需要更多的CPU和内存资源时,vCenter Server可以自动从其他虚拟机中回收空闲资源,并将其分配给该虚拟机使用

     3.高可用性与容错:VMware提供了多种高可用性和容错机制,以确保虚拟化环境的稳定运行

    例如,vMotion技术可以实现虚拟机在不同ESXi主机之间的实时迁移,而无需中断服务;HA(高可用性)功能则可以在ESXi主机出现故障时,自动将虚拟机迁移到其他正常的ESXi主机上运行,避免了服务的中断

     三、VMware服务器虚拟化架构的优势 VMware服务器虚拟化架构以其独特的优势,成为了企业IT架构升级的首选方案

    具体来说,这些优势包括: 1.提高资源利用率:通过虚拟化技术,企业可以将多个物理服务器整合为虚拟服务器集群,实现硬件资源的最大化利用

    这不仅降低了硬件成本,还减少了占地空间和电力消耗,降低了运营成本

     2.增强灵活性与可扩展性:虚拟化架构使得应用程序的部署和迁移变得更加灵活和快速

    企业可以根据业务需求,轻松地添加或删除虚拟机,调整资源分配,以适应不断变化的市场环境

     3.提高系统稳定性与安全性:虚拟化架构提供了多种高可用性和容错机制,确保了系统的稳定运行

    同时,通过虚拟化技术,企业可以将关键应用程序和数据隔离在独立的虚拟机中,提高了系统的安全性

     4.简化管理与维护:vCenter Server提供了对虚拟化环境的集中管理和监控功能,使得管理员可以轻松地管理数百台ESXi主机和数千个虚拟机

    这不仅降低了管理成本,还提高了管理效率

     四、VMware服务器虚拟化架构的应用场景 VMware服务器虚拟化架构广泛应用于各种场景中,为企业带来了显著的效益

    以下是一些典型的应用场景: 1.数据中心整合:通过虚拟化技术,企业可以将多个数据中心整合为一个虚拟数据中心,实现资源的集中管理和优化利用

    这不仅降低了硬件成本,还提高了资源的利用率和灵活性

     2.业务连续性与灾难恢复:虚拟化架构提供了多种高可用性和容错机制,确保了业务的连续运行

    同时,通过虚拟化技术,企业可以轻松地实现数据的备份和恢复,提高了灾难恢复能力

     3.开发与测试环境:虚拟化架构为开发和测试团队提供了一个快速、灵活、可重复的测试环境

    开发人员可以在虚拟机中部署和测试应用程序,无需担心对生产环境的影响

    这不仅加速了产品的开发和迭代速度,还提高了产品的质量

     4.云桌面应用:通过虚拟化技术,企业可以构建云桌面系统,为用户提供远程访问和操作虚拟桌面的能力

    这不仅提高了用户的工作效率,还降低了设备更换的成本和维护难度

     五、VMware服务器虚拟化架构的未来展望 随着技术的不断发展和应用场景的不断拓展,VMware服务器虚拟化架构将面临更多的挑战和机遇

    未来,我们可以期待以下几个方面的发展: 1.智能虚拟化技术:利用人工智能和机器学习技术来优化虚拟化环境的资源分配、故障预测和运维管理等过程,提高虚拟化环境的智能化水平和运维效率

     2.绿色虚拟化技术:随着环保意识的提高和能源消耗的日益严峻,未来虚拟化技术可能会更加注重节能降耗和绿色计算等方面的研究和应用

     3.容器化与云原生技术的融合:随着容器化技术的普及和应用场景的拓展,未来VMware服务器虚拟化架构可能会与容器化和云原生技术进行深度融合和集成,形成更加完整和高效的解决方案,推动云计算技术的进一步发展和应用

     结语 VMware服务器虚拟化架构以其独特的设计理念和强大的功能,为企业IT架构升级带来了革命性的变革

    通过深入了解这一架构的工作原理、优势以及应用场景,我们可以更好地把握虚拟化技术的优势和特点,并在实际工作中加以应用和创新

    同时,随着技术的不断发展和应用场景的不断拓展,我们有理由相信,VMware服务器虚拟化架构将在未来继续发挥更大的作用,为企业数字化转型和云原生应用部署提供更加高效、可靠和智能的技术支持和服务

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道